#33012f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33012f is composed of 20% red, 0.4%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98% magenta, 7.8%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 304.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 10.2%. #33012f color hex could be obtained by blending #66025e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#33012f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33012f has RGB values of R:51, G:1,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.08,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 3342639.

Shades and Tints of #33012f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d000c is the darkest color, while #fff8fe is the lightest one.
